What is a ‘kitchen facelift’?

A kitchen facelift makes the most of what you already have and simply revitalises the cosmetic aspects that are on show, such as cupboard doors, cabinet fronts, drawers and even the fixtures and fittings like hinges, handles and trim. It can also include other large-area and highly visible aspects such as the kitchen worktops, the floor and of course, the décor.

What you keep is the part of the kitchen that’s usually hidden away but is still perfectly serviceable, including the units themselves. For most people the layout they already have works perfectly well for them, and if pushed most people would prefer a simple cosmetic makeover rather than a full revamp. Not only is it quicker to complete, but it costs a fraction of the price of a full rebuild too – money you can then spend on other aspects of your home, or even a nice holiday!

Call in the experts

However, a kitchen facelift isn’t something to be tackled if you don’t have the DIY experience or expertise. Think that it’s ‘easy’ to hang a kitchen cupboard door properly? Think again! Even if your kitchen is a pretty standard, generic fitted one, over time it will change, primarily due to the effects of heat and humidity. So even a standard cupboard door may no longer fit perfectly, and if it’s out even by a couple of millimetres you won’t get that perfect bespoke look you want.

By calling in experts who can create kitchen cupboard doors, drawers and worktops that are tailor-made for your exact specifications, you can achieve the best possible finish, and still at an affordable price.

Keep it simple

If your budget is really tight then you can still do plenty yourself to spruce up your kitchen and give it a makeover, if not a complete facelift. From a lick of paint through to replacing door handles, hinges or trim, you can transform the look of a tired kitchen in an afternoon.
